What you need for creamy lemon chicken breast

Chicken breast β or boneless skinless thigh
Chicken broth/stock β gives the sauce flavour (itβs pretty dull without it)
Cream and lemon β because weβre making aΒ creamy lemon sauce
Parmesan β forΒ umami AND to help thicken the sauce
Mustard β sauce thickening and extra flavour/tang
Flour β to dust chicken (gives it a crust that the sauce wants to cling to, optional)
Garlic β because garlic goes in 99% of my savoury foods
Butter β because butter makes everything better
How to make creamy lemon chicken breast
Youβre 10 minutes away from having this for dinner!

Hereβs how it goes down:
Sprinkle chicken with salt and pepper, dust with flour;
Pan fry until golden then remove
Add everything else in, then simmer for 3 minutes until thickened;
Return chicken into skillet to rewarm; and
Serve over pasta, mashed potato or for a low carb option, Creamy Mashed Cauliflower.

Creamy Lemon Chicken Breast
Ingredients
Crispy Chicken
- 600g / 1.2lb chicken breasts (2 large) (Note 1)
- 1/2 tsp cooking salt (kosher salt)
- 1/4 tsp Black pepper
- 1/4 cup flour (plain / all-purpose)
- 40g / 3 tbsp butter , unsalted
- 1 β 2 garlic clove, minced
- 1 1/4 cups chicken broth/stock
- 3/4 cup cream , heavy/thickened (Note 2)
- 3 β 4 tbsp lemon juice (adjust to taste, start with 3 tbsp)
- 2 tsp Dijon mustard
- 3/4 cup parmesan cheese , freshly grated OR store bought finely shredded (Note 3)
To serve
- Pasta of choice (I used linguine)
- Finely chopped parsley
Instructions
Crispy Chicken
- Slice chicken breast horizontally to create two thin steaks (so you end up with 4 thin steaks in total).
- Sprinkle each side with salt and pepper, then coat with flour, shaking off excess.
- Melt butter in a large skillet over medium high heat. Cook chicken 2 minutes on each side until golden and crispy, then remove onto plate.
Sauce
- Add a touch of butter if your pan is dry β but you shouldn't need it. Add garlic, stir 10 seconds.
- Then add chicken broth, cream, lemon and Dijon mustard. Bring to simmer and scrape the bottom of the pan to dissolve brown bits into the liquid. Use a whisk if needed to dissolve mustard.
- Add parmesan then simmer rapidly for 3 minutes or until sauce thickens slightly. Add salt, pepper and adjust lemon to taste.
- Return the chicken to the pan (pour in any juices on the plate too), turn to coat.
- Place chicken on serving plates with pasta or mashed potatoes. Sprinkle with fresh parsley if using. Spoon over Lemon Sauce and serve! (Bread for mopping wouldn't go astray either)
